When a body is said to be in motion ? What do you mean by motion in one direction ?

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

### Step-by-Step Solution: 1. **Definition of Motion**: A body is said to be in motion when its position changes with respect to its immediate surroundings. This means that if you observe an object and notice that it has moved from one place to another, it is considered to be in motion. 2. **Example of Motion**: For instance, if you are running and the trees around you remain stationary relative to your position, you are moving from point A to point B. In this case, your position is changing, indicating that you are in motion. 3. **Understanding Motion in One Direction**: Motion in one direction refers to the movement of an object along a straight path without changing its direction.
